Elmstone itself has no hotels, but its position just off the A257 between Canterbury and Sandwich makes it a convenient base for exploring East Kent by car while staying somewhere with a bit more choice. Canterbury, a short drive to the southwest, has the widest range of accommodation in the area, from historic coaching inns within the city walls to modern chain hotels on its outskirts, all within easy reach of the cathedral, shops and restaurants. Sandwich offers smaller, characterful options in its medieval centre, and villages such as Wingham and Preston have bed and breakfasts set among the farmland that surrounds Elmstone. Coastal towns like Herne Bay and Whitstable, around 20-25 minutes away, add seaside guesthouses and hotels to the mix for those who want sea air alongside their countryside stay. Because Elmstone is so small, most visitors treat it as a peaceful stopover rather than a hotel destination in its own right, choosing nearby Canterbury or Sandwich for the night and using Elmstone's quiet lanes as a scenic route through to the coast or cathedral city. Whichever base is chosen, the whole area is compact enough that no accommodation is more than a short drive from the region's main sights, making it easy to combine a rural night's stay with full access to Canterbury's history and the Kent coastline.
